Understanding the Ketogenic Diet: A Deep Dive

Before delving into personalized keto plans, let's establish a firm understanding of the ketogenic diet itself. At its core, keto is a very low-carbohydrate, high-fat diet. This macronutrient ratio forces the body into a metabolic state called ketosis. In ketosis, the body shifts from primarily burning glucose (from carbohydrates) for energy to burning ketones, which are produced from the breakdown of fats. This metabolic shift has significant implications for weight loss and overall health, but also potential drawbacks that need careful consideration.

Ketosis: The Metabolic Switch

The transition to ketosis isn't immediate. It typically takes a few days to a few weeks, depending on individual factors like metabolism, carbohydrate intake, and gut microbiome composition. During this adaptation period, some individuals experience "keto flu" symptoms such as fatigue, headache, and nausea. These are generally temporary and subside as the body adjusts. Once in ketosis, the body becomes incredibly efficient at burning fat for fuel, leading to weight loss. However, the process is nuanced; it’s not simply a matter of reducing carbohydrates. The type and quality of fats consumed, along with protein intake, play crucial roles in successful keto adaptation and long-term adherence.

Macronutrient Ratios: Precision and Personalization

While a standard ketogenic diet often suggests a macronutrient ratio of 70-80% fat, 20-25% protein, and 5-10% carbohydrates, a truly personalized plan acknowledges individual variations. Factors such as age, activity level, gender, underlying health conditions (e.g., diabetes, kidney disease), and even genetic predispositions influence optimal macronutrient needs. A blanket approach ignores these crucial differences, potentially leading to suboptimal results or even adverse effects. A personalized plan carefully considers these factors to tailor the macronutrient ratio to maximize effectiveness and minimize risks.

The Importance of a Personalized Keto Plan

A generic keto diet plan, readily available online or in books, is unlikely to be perfectly suited for everyone. What works wonders for one person might be ineffective or even harmful for another. This is where personalized keto plans shine. They address the unique needs and characteristics of each individual, offering a higher chance of success and minimizing potential side effects. This personalization goes beyond simply adjusting macronutrient ratios. It encompasses:

  • Dietary Preferences and Restrictions: A personalized plan accounts for food allergies, intolerances, and preferences. Are you vegetarian, vegan, or do you have specific dislikes? A good plan will work around these limitations.
  • Lifestyle Factors: Your activity level, work schedule, and social life significantly impact your ability to adhere to a diet. A personalized plan considers these factors to create a realistic and sustainable approach.
  • Health Goals: Are you aiming for weight loss, improved blood sugar control, or enhanced athletic performance? A personalized plan tailors its strategies to your specific objectives.
  • Health Conditions: Pre-existing health conditions require careful consideration. For instance, individuals with kidney disease may need to adjust their protein intake, while those with diabetes need close monitoring of blood sugar levels.

Crafting a Custom Keto Meal Plan: A Step-by-Step Guide

Creating a truly personalized keto plan often involves consulting with a registered dietitian or healthcare professional experienced in ketogenic diets. However, understanding the key steps involved empowers you to make informed decisions and work effectively with your healthcare provider. Here's a structured approach:

1. Assessment and Goal Setting:

This initial phase involves a thorough assessment of your current health status, dietary habits, lifestyle, and goals. This might include blood tests, physical examinations, and detailed questionnaires. Clearly defined, realistic, and measurable goals are essential for success.

2. Macronutrient Calculation:

Based on your assessment, a personalized macronutrient ratio is calculated. This involves determining your daily caloric needs and then dividing those calories among fats, proteins, and carbohydrates according to your specific needs and goals. Online calculators can help, but professional guidance is invaluable.

3. Meal Planning and Recipe Selection:

This phase focuses on creating a meal plan that aligns with your macronutrient targets and dietary preferences. This involves selecting keto-friendly recipes and ensuring adequate intake of essential vitamins and minerals. Variety is crucial to prevent boredom and nutrient deficiencies.

4. Tracking and Adjustment:

Regular monitoring of your progress is vital. This might involve tracking your weight, blood ketone levels (using a ketone meter), and overall well-being. Based on this data, adjustments to the plan might be necessary to optimize results and address any challenges.

Addressing Common Concerns and Misconceptions

The ketogenic diet, while effective for many, is often surrounded by misconceptions. Let's address some common concerns:

  • Is keto safe for everyone? No. Individuals with certain medical conditions, such as pancreatitis or gallbladder disease, should proceed with caution and consult their doctor before starting a ketogenic diet.
  • Will I experience nutrient deficiencies? A well-planned keto diet provides all necessary nutrients. However, careful attention to food choices and supplementation (if necessary) is crucial.
  • Is keto sustainable long-term? While the initial transition can be challenging, many individuals successfully maintain a ketogenic lifestyle long-term. Sustainability relies on finding a balance between dietary adherence and enjoyment.
  • What about "keto flu"? The keto flu, characterized by fatigue, headache, and nausea, is a common initial side effect. Staying hydrated, supplementing electrolytes, and gradually reducing carbohydrate intake can help minimize these symptoms.
